Understanding How These Public Records Systems Function
At its core, the system behind Cook County Illinois Inmate Roster: View Current and Past Inmates is a digital repository of official court and correctional data managed by the Cook County Sheriff's Office and the Circuit Court of Cook County. These systems are designed to maintain accurate records of individuals booked into county detention facilities as well as those processed through the judicial system. When a person is arrested and held in a Cook County facility, their information is entered into this database, typically including details such as name, date of birth, booking timestamp, assigned identifier, charge details, and current status. The interface allowing public search is a tool for transparency, enabling friends, family, researchers, and concerned citizens to track the progression of cases without needing direct contact with the institutions.
The functionality is generally straightforward, built to serve a wide range of users. A visitor to the official portal can usually input a name or date of birth to retrieve current detainees. For Cook County Illinois Inmate Roster: View Current and Past Inmates, the system may also allow filtering by specific criteria such as case status or facility location. It is important to understand that the data displayed reflects a snapshot in time; an individual listed as "detained" may have been processed, bonded out, or moved to another jurisdiction. Similarly, records of past arrests often remain visible to provide a complete history, though the legal status updates in real-time as the judicial process moves forward. These databases operate under strict guidelines to ensure the accuracy of the information they publish, balancing public right-to-know with the privacy rights of individuals.

Another frequent question pertains to the reliability and freshness of the information presented. Users want to know if the data they are viewing is live or delayed. Most official jail roster systems update multiple times per day, but there is often a processing lag between an arrest and the appearance of the record online. This delay is standard procedure, allowing time for photographing, fingerprinting, and classification. Consequently, someone may have been released hours before a search yields a "detained" status. Recognizing this operational reality prevents confusion and underscores that these tools are best used for verification and general awareness rather than real-time GPS tracking. Accuracy is paramount, and the systems are designed to reflect the official status as reported by the correctional authorities.

However, it is equally important to consider the limitations and responsible use of this information. The data presented is factual regarding charges and custody status but does not provide context or outcome. An arrest record visible online does not equate to guilt, as cases often result in dropped charges, acquittals, or alternative resolutions. Relying solely on this snapshot for judgment can lead to misinformation. Furthermore, the perpetual visibility of arrest records, even for cases that never lead to conviction, raises important conversations about digital permanence and its impact on individuals' lives. Using this powerful tool with empathy and an understanding that public records tell only part of a complex human story is essential for responsible engagement.
